Accommodation Policy & General Information in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za

Important Note
Planning to check in outside the check-in time (such as early morning or late in the evening)? You can arrange it directly with the property!
  • Fee for buffet breakfast: approximately JPY 3630 per person

The above list may not be comprehensive. Fees and deposits may not include tax and are subject to change.

You'll be asked to pay the following charges at the property. Fees may include applicable taxes:

  • The city tax ranges from JPY 100-200 per person, per night based on the nightly room rate. The tax does not apply to nightly rates under JPY 10,000. Please note that further exemptions may apply. For more details, please contact the office using the information on the reservation confirmation received after booking.

We have included all charges provided to us by the property.

  • Extra-person charges may apply and vary depending on property policy
  • Government-issued photo identification and a credit card, debit card, or cash deposit may be required at check-in for incidental charges
  • Special requests are subject to availability upon check-in and may incur additional charges; special requests cannot be guaranteed
  • This property accepts credit cards; cash is not accepted
  • Please note that cultural norms and guest policies may differ by country and by property; the policies listed are provided by the property

This property doesn't offer after-hours check-in. Front desk staff will greet guests on arrival at the property. Guests must be at least 20 years to stay in a smoking room.

Hotel only accepts guests with minimum age of 18

Frequently asked question in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za

What are available facilities at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za?
There are top facilites at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za such as Restaurant, 24-Hour Front Desk, WiFi, Elevator. (some may require extra charges)
What is normal check-in & check-out time at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za?
The standard check-in time at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za is starting from 15:00 - 00:30 while the latest check-out time is at Before 12:00
Does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za provide breakfast?
Yes,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za provides breakfast. However, you need to choose a room with breakfast or pay extra charge if you book a room without breakfast.
What is the star rating of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za?
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za is a 4.5-star hotel.
How many floors does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za have?
Millennium Mitsui Garden Hotel Tokyo/Ginza has 14 floors.
